QuickTime or Java?

QuickTime

To view QuickTime VR (or QTVR) you need the QuickTime Plug-In, Apple’s FREE cross platform multi media player. QuickTime is one of the most popular multimedia technologies and in addition being able to view QuickTime VR panoramas, it enables you to view numerous types of digital media for both Macintosh and PC.

QuickTime comes pre-installed on all Macintosh computers. PC users can easily download and install QuickTime from the Apple website. Click here for further instructions.

QuickTime offers slightly better image quality over java, especially when viewing the higher resolution full screen 360º panoramas, and we believe the download is well worthwhile.


Java

As an alternative to QuickTime VR we also offer 360º Java panoramas, primarily for PC users who do not want to install QuickTime. The advantage of Java is that the majority of web browsers have built-in java support so you do not need to download any further software.

The functionality of the two systems is very much the same, as is the way they are viewed by the user.
